# Quotas: Spindlecart Queue Migration

The legacy homegrown job queue is retired. All plugins must enqueue through the Spindlecart broker API. Per-plugin quotas are enforced at admission: payload size, concurrency, and retry budget. Jobs exceeding quota are rejected, not queued. Backoff is mandatory and broker-controlled. Current enforced limits are listed below.

tuning constants:
QUOTAS = {
    "druwyn": 5,
    "holix": 5,
    "zorath": 5,
    "holwyn": 10,
}

Subject: Transcode farm ownership change

Effective immediately, the Quillhaven transcoding farm is no longer owned by the platform team. Paging policy unchanged: sev-1 on encoder queue depth over 10k, sev-2 on stuck worker pools. Runbooks moved to the Brindlemoor wiki space. Do not restart the Fennwick dispatcher without approval. All escalations for the farm now go to the person listed below.

named custodian: Brivan Eliath Quenox Frador

# Break-Glass: Catalog Cache Invalidation

Scope: the Pinrow product catalog at Veldstone Retail. If stale prices persist after a purge and the Hollowmere invalidation queue is wedged, use break-glass to flush the edge tier directly. Contractors: get verbal sign-off from the catalog lead first. Steps: open the Hollowmere admin shell, select emergency-flush, confirm the tenant, and run it once — repeated flushes thrash the origin. Access is logged and expires after 20 minutes. Unseal the admin shell with the passphrase below.

recovery phrase for kahop-tajog: istix-casvan

FAQ: Why is the Lanternfall build migrating to the hermetic Quarrybuild system? Because network fetches during compile caused irreproducible artifacts. All dependencies are now pinned in the vendored snapshot, and toolchains resolve from the sealed cache. If the sealed cache keyring locks during migration, do not regenerate it. Instead, restore access with the recovery passphrase noted directly below this entry.

unlock words, yagag-yahog: gordor-zorvan-druius-queniel-normir-norwyn-framir-novmir-ralius-holwyn-wenwyn-tamael-silok-holdor